Subject: [Buildroot] [PATCH 1/1] utils/test-pkg: Generate package config if it is not specified

It is possible to generate one-line config for the package just by
normalize it to the form:
BR2_PACKAGE_${pkg_replaced-to_and_uppercase}
it simplifes a bit of testing package where no additional config options
are needed.

---
utils/test-pkg | 17 ++++++++++++++++-
1 file changed, 16 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/utils/test-pkg b/utils/test-pkg
index 1995fa8..cce4679 100755
--- a/utils/test-pkg
+++ b/utils/test-pkg
@@ -2,12 +2,20 @@
set -e
TOOLCHAINS_CSV='support/config-fragments/autobuild/toolchain-configs.csv'
+TEMP_CONF=""
+
+do_clean() {
+ if [ ! -z "${TEMP_CONF}" ]; then
+ rm -f "${TEMP_CONF}"
+ fi
+}
main() {
local o O opts
local cfg dir pkg random toolchains_dir toolchain all number mode
local ret nb nb_skip nb_fail nb_legal nb_tc build_dir
local -a toolchains
+ local pkg_br_name
o='hac:d:n:p:r:t:'
O='help,config-snippet:build-dir:package:,random:,toolchains-dir:'
@@ -50,8 +58,15 @@ main() {
;;
esac
done
+
+ trap do_clean INT TERM HUP EXIT
+
if [ -z "${cfg}" ]; then
- printf "error: no config snippet specified\n" >&2; exit 1
+ pkg_br_name="${pkg//-/_}"
+ pkg_br_name="BR2_PACKAGE_${pkg_br_name^^}"
+ TEMP_CONF=$(mktemp /tmp/test-${pkg}-config.XXXXXX)
+ echo "${pkg_br_name}=y" > ${TEMP_CONF}
+ cfg="${TEMP_CONF}"
fi
if [ ! -e "${cfg}" ]; then
printf "error: %s: no such file\n" "${cfg}" >&2; exit 1
